Dr. Jitendra Singh calls for tackling Insurgency issue with customized solutions

MoS (PMO) emphasizes on police modernization with integrated expertise

Union Minister of State (Independent Charge) of the Ministry of Development of North Eastern Region (DoNER), MoS PMO, Personnel, Public Grievances & Pensions, Atomic Energy and Space, Dr. Jitendra Singh has said that CAPFs and State Police has come of age to tackle the menace of insurgency. He saidthat new and evolved Technology should be utilized to tackle the insurgency and terrorism effectively. Dr. Jitendra Singh said this while addressing the 6th International Conference on Homeland Security here today. The theme of the Conference is ‘Integrated Approach to Security’ with the Session titled ‘Operational Challenges in Counter Insurgency and Solutions. Dr. Jitendra Singh said that the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s vision of ‘New India’ can become a success if safe and secure India become the mantra. He also exhorted the stakeholders to evolve a value based system with high morals, so the young generation is not diverted from the path of discipline, growth and development. 

He also praised the high competence and technological efforts and prowess of the Security Forces and Intelligence Agencies to address the security issues. He said Cyber Security needs to be revisited with sustained renewed vigor so that the country is not lagging in global technological advancement sphere. Dr. Jitendra Singh said that the latest researches needs to synergized with the requirements to evolve an effective and efficient Counter Insurgency strategy. Dr. Jitendra Singh said that driven by the inspiration of the Prime Minister Shri Narendra Modi’s clarion call and constant strive for excellence in security domain, he said the incidence of insurgency has reduced enormously in J&K with the proactive and pre-emptive approach of the Government in addressing the menace of cross-border terrorism. Dr. Jitendra Singh said that every solution in the realm of Insurgency issue should be customized based on region specific requirements of the state, terrain of the region and local populace. 

He emphasized the need for Research and Development (R&D) in this area and to develop the technological solutions with an endeavor rooted in Indian conditions to address the region specific issues of insurgency. He underlined the importance of best practices and policies driven with the sole objective of police modernization and development of security forces with integrated expertise driven approach. He said that there is a quintessential need to be aware of the Human Rights while addressing the law and order and security issues. He said in the recent past, the J&K Special Operations Group has done a commendable job in nabbing the militants and their efforts are setting a new benchmark for the security apparatus. He said that the confidence of people in the borders have accentuated with the decisive action of the Government. He said that the core solution to the insurgency issues should be based on the pillars of clarity and conviction.
